LL.B. (Hons.) Semester - X Examination, April 2017

--- Content provided by‌ FirstRanker.com ---

INDIAN EVIDENCE ACT

Duration: 3 Hours

Total Marks: 75

Instructions: 1) Answer any eight questions from Q.No. 1 to 12.

2) Q. 13 and Q. 14 are compulsory.

  1. Explain the term fact. Distinguish between fact in issue and relevant facts. (8x8=64)
  2. Explain the doctrine of Res Gestae.
  3. Examine how facts which are the occasion, cause or effect of facts in issue are relevant.
  4. Examine the concept of admission under the Indian Evidence Act.
  5. Define dying declaration and explain its evidentiary value.

  7. "Any fact is relevant which shows or constitutes a motive or preparation and conduct of any fact in issue or relevant fact". Explain.
  8. Briefly examine facts which need not be proved under Sec. 56.
  9. Discuss the law regarding competency of a witness Under Sections 118-121 of Indian Evidence Act.
  10. Briefly examine the concept of relevancy under Indian Evidence Act.
  11. Analyse the rules of determining Burden of Proof in a suit or proceeding.

  13. Explain when anything said or done or written by one conspirator is admissible against others.
  14. Discuss the various modes of examination of witnesses.

13. Write short notes on any two : (21/2x2=5)

  1. Hearsay evidence
  2. Child witness

  4. Kinds of evidence.

14. Write short notes on any two: (2x3=6)

  1. Communication during marriage.
  2. Confession to Police Officer.
  3. Public Documents.
